After the typhoon Yolanda struck the Philippines, the schools in the affected areas got totally or partially destroyed. The interiors and learning materials where in most cases also damaged. The Department of Education will be handing out new textbooks in the public schools. But most of the schools used to have a little library attached containing encyclopedias, other factual books and a selection of novels. These books are of big importance for the ability to study, and there for something the schools now are in need of.

Through assessments together with principals and teachers in elementary schools outside of Tacloban city we have got to know that the biggest need is factual books, storybooks and also encyclopedias and dictionaries.We are looking into donate as many books we possibly can!
